Performance
The Google Tensor G2 (5nm) chipset in the Pixel 7a represents a substantial leap in performance over the Unisoc T7200 (12nm) found in the Doogee U11 Pro. The Tensor G2’s Cortex-X1 prime core, clocked at 2.85 GHz, provides significantly faster processing speeds for demanding tasks like video editing and gaming. The 5nm fabrication process also contributes to better thermal efficiency, reducing the likelihood of throttling during sustained workloads. The Doogee’s Cortex-A75 cores, while capable, are simply outmatched by the Tensor G2’s architecture. This difference will be most noticeable in app launch times, multitasking, and overall system responsiveness.
Battery Life
The Doogee U11 Pro’s 131:38h endurance rating is truly remarkable, dwarfing the Pixel 7a’s 76h rating. This translates to potentially days of use on a single charge, making it ideal for travelers or users who frequently find themselves away from power outlets. However, the Doogee’s 10W wired charging is significantly slower than the Pixel 7a’s 18W wired charging with PD3.0 and 7.5W wireless charging. While the Doogee excels in longevity, the Pixel 7a offers more convenient and faster charging options.
